Casi Jewett has a masters degree in organizational development and is an HR consultant serving many diverse industries in the public sector and small business.

In this podcast episode, we’re discussing the need to respect and honor introverts in your workplace. Whether you manage introverts or you are an introvert leader yourself, you’ll discover how to “find the gold” to ensure your success.

What you will learn …

  • How introversion is a strength, not a weakness.
  • What are the challenges and gifts of leading as an introvert?
  • How introverts can harness their natural gifts and be recognized for how they add value without feeling like they have to be someone else.
  • Tips for understanding and using the powers of introversion in the workplace.
  • How and why to have the “I’m an introvert” conversation with your boss
